Local Boy Scouts will be devoting Saturday, March 15 to a major clean-up effort in Dexter.
Many limbs and branches remain in yards across town as a result of the February ice storms. Scout Troop 200 will be available and will be working with members of Dexter's Street Department to help remove limbs from the yards of elderly residents in the area as well as those who have handicapping conditions that prevent them from clearing their yards of the aftermath from the storms.
Those in need of help are asked to register by contacting the Dexter Water Department at 624-5527 or by calling City Hall at 624-5959. Calls should be placed no later than noon on Wednesday, March 12.
